I'd also recommend looking into Flash if you're seriously interested in animating, Gimp and Photoshop have some decent options for animations, but they won't get you terribly far. I'm sure you could find some open source/completely free alternatives to Flash too though.

  15. They're quite right, although I have actually seen some decent RuneScape signatures, it's still usually a no-no. You wouldn't start with a low quality, blurry, jpeg-erized stock image, so starting with a screenshot of a game that just doesn't look great isn't the best idea either. Apart from that, V1 is a lot better. The second version looks pixely, blurry and LQ because of the glowy effects. V1 is also quite blurry and the effect on the text and blurred background don't work, but it's better.
